Pineapple: Tropical Enzyme Powerhouse

Pineapple is not just tasty; it also helps with weight management. Its high bromelain content makes it great for burning fat naturally. Adding it to your diet can be a smart move.

pineapple benefits

Bromelain and Its Effect on Fat Digestion

Bromelain, found in pineapple, is key to protein digestion. It breaks down proteins better, helping with fat digestion. This makes digestion smoother and supports weight management.

For best results, eat pineapple with a balanced diet and exercise. It's a tasty way to support your weight loss efforts.

Vitamin C and Metabolic Support

Pineapple is packed with vitamin C, important for metabolism. Vitamin C helps make carnitine, which moves fatty acids to be burned for energy. This boosts your body's fat-burning power.

Vitamin C also fights oxidative stress, which can slow metabolism. Eating foods high in vitamin C, like pineapple, can help keep your metabolism strong.

Cherries: Nature's Fat-Burning Jewels

Cherries are more than just a tasty summer treat. They are packed with nutrients that help with weight management. This makes them a great choice for those looking to lose weight.

Anthocyanins and Their Effect on Fat Cells

The deep red color of cherries comes from anthocyanins. These antioxidants are powerful and affect fat cells. Anthocyanins can reduce inflammation and boost metabolic health. This makes it easier to burn fat.

Studies suggest these compounds can change how the body stores fat. This could lead to less body fat.

Sleep Improvement and Weight Management Connection

Cherries are a natural source of melatonin. This hormone helps regulate sleep. Good sleep quality is linked to better weight management. Poor sleep can lead to weight gain.

Eating cherries or drinking cherry juice can improve sleep. This supports weight loss efforts.

Seasonal Availability and Storage Tips

Cherries are in season from May to August, peaking in June and July. To enjoy them all year, freeze or dry them. Proper storage is key to keeping their nutrients. Fresh cherries should be refrigerated and eaten within a few days.

Frozen cherries can last up to a year. Just remember to remove the pits before freezing.
